OVERVIEW
The lead PV installer is responsible for assembling the mechanical portion of a PV system. This includes installing feet, racking and the panels as designed by the engineering team. Accuracy and safety are important to Rising Sun. It is important that the Installers follow and promote all company protocols ensuring overall efficiency. Crew Leaders ultimately lead by example by ensuring best safety practices and the completion of solar projects.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Responsible for maintaining vehicle clean by cleaning out all trash from the day before (cardboard), submit part returns, throughout the day ensures parts are put back in their place
  • Prepare for day’s work by filling water coolers with fresh water ensuring enough for team
  • Pulls and provides directions to pull materials and tools and restock vehicle with install equipment and material
  • Performs general site preparation and continuous job-site clean-up by putting up the tent and setting up work table, staging tools and charging them, pulling materials
  • Directs which materials hauled onto roof for installation
  • Perform any preparation for rail installation: measure, cut and splice rail
  • Directs layout of PV system by using drawings and PV knowledge to ensure proper placement
  • Maintain constant communication with their crew members on the status of task completion and are proactive in accomplishing all tasks assigned and those necessary for the job.
  • Participates in regular safety practices learns safety protocols to apply at job site
  • Maintains a neat and professional appearance, job site and communicates with the customers in a positive manner.
  • Prepare the roof for attachment points by neatly cutting/lifting shingles where flashing will be placed.
  • Prepare lag bolts and washers to connect to flashings, install
  • Performs geocell application on any of the attachment points to create waterproofing
  • Mounts rails onto L brackets and leveling all racking
  • Performs bonding of all rails
  • Pass up panels

  • Installs fall protection safety equipment on job site
  • Performs home runs and installing opOmarizers and collecting stickers and mapping them correctly. Making sure wire management is clean and organized by not touching the roof or exposed to direct sunlight.
  • Ensures MC4 connectors are installed properly
  • Ensures proper lay out of panels, making sure space is consistent, and panels are all level
  • Trims ends of rail and places end caps. Ensures to clean up any shavings from roof
  • Prepares material lists for the following day
  • Tests strings/voltage and documenting
  • Ensure collection of all photos throughout the entire process of installation and upload by the end of the day.
  • Troubleshooting reverse polarity in the even that testing is not showing correct voltage reading

WORKING CONDITIONS
While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to sit, climb, bend, kneel, balance,
stoop, walk and reach. The employee will frequently be required to lift and/or move up to 75 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and ability to adjust focus. Comfortable climbing ladders plus on occasion standing and working on rooftops (single and multiple level stories in both hot and cold weather).
